I have aluminum banjo fittings on my turbo, the anodizing is heat faded but they did not melt. I too have a good thermal siphon. I think that is something that is commonly overlooked when installing a turbo. The steel is a helluva lot cheaper though.


I could not find a -10 bender that would do a tight radius and allow me to make a hardline turbo drain that way. I ended up purchasing a -10 adapter to bolt to the bottom on the turbo then bought a -10 fitting with the pipe coming out of it and welded the flex joint from the stock turbo drain to it and modified a few other things as well. It was a PITA, especially with the engine in the car. I may remake it so it is a bit cleaner than what I have.
